520 _aThis article argues for the establishment of national children's programmes and centres based on similar child focused centres established in the United Kingdom and United States. The paper compares statistics on child poverty and maltreatment in New Zealand with overseas rates includes discussion on poverty, mental health and adult disease, and factors contributing to poor indicators for children in New Zealand. A background to the "Sure Start" programme for children in the UK is given. The results of a community consultation with a similar programme "Timata Pai"(start well) based in Wellsford are presented, along with proposed plans for a dedicated children's centre in the area. The authors' call for attention to New Zealand's obligations under the United Nations Convention on the Rights of the Child in the development of services for children and families.
